SUNYAC Softball Championship Day 3 Recap

Cortland N.Y. - During Day 3 of The State University of New York Athletic Conference (SUNYAC) Softball Tournament, Oswego was eliminated and a series matchup between the one seed, Cortland and the two seed Geneseo, is tied up.

Game 9: Cortland vs. Oswego

In an elimination matchup for both Cortland and Oswego, Cortland dominated throughout the entire game. The Red Dragons defeated the Lakers with the final score of 7-0. Kelly O'Gorman helped Cortland escape elimination with three hits, two RBI and two runs. Hannah Feldman also had two RBI and a home run. Pitching for Cortland for the elimination game was Sam Van Dorn striking out five and giving up only two hits. 

Game 10: Cortland vs. Geneseo

The Cortland Red Dragons live to see another day as the tie up their series matchup against the Geneseo Knights. In the top inning of the fifth Cortland was able to bring six runners home to gain a 6-0 lead against Geneseo. In an attempt to end the tournament after Cortland scored another run at the top of the seventh the Geneseo Knights were able to rally in three runs in the seventh, falling short of the win. In this important match Cortland had Cady Walts on the mound. Walts was able to get seven strike outs allowing six hits and three runs.    

Whats Next

With Cortland and Geneseo having one loss each, Sunday, May 4 at 12 p.m. is set to be the SUNYAC Softball Tournament Final. With Cortland being the number one seed, the Red Dragons will host the championship game.
